Measurement Menu

The Measurement menu gives you access to setup various measurement types, such as Spectrum, RF,
and a variety of modulation measurements.

Table 4-13. Measurement Menu

Spectrum

Measurement Type

Spectrum Measurement Type: To change the measurement type, press on the
Measurement Type button and select one of the following measurement types from the
fly-out menu:

Spectrum: Selects the spectrum analysis mode (frequency domain)
RF: Selects the RF measurement mode (see below)
QAM/PSK: Selects the modulation measurement mode (see below)
WCDMA: Selects the modulation measurement mode (see below)
WiMAX: Launches the WiMAX Analysis application (requires Options 22 and 41)
Phase Noise: Launches the Phase Noise Measurement application (requires
Option 52)

Standard: This selection allows you to select a measurement standard that
automatically configures all of the measurement parameters. To select a measurement
standard, press on the Standard button and select the desired standard from the fly-out
menu.

RF Measurement Types:

OBW: Measures the occupied bandwidth of the signal
TOI: Measures the third order intercept of the signal
Channel Power: Measures the channel power of the signal
ACP: Measures the adjacent channel power of the signal
Multicarrier Channel Power: Measures the channel power of up to 12 carriers
along with the adjacent and two alternate channel powers.
CCDF: Displays the Complementary Cumulative Distribution Function (CCDF)
curves and summary detail.
Spectrum Masks: Displays the spectrum mask lines and verifies spectral
compliance in a summary.
